Why Aaron Taylor-Johnson is the Top Contender

Aaron Taylor-Johnson has been a name frequently whispered in the corridors of Bond fandom and industry insiders. Why? Well, there are several compelling reasons. First off, the dude has serious acting experience. He's not just a pretty face. He has a proven track record of delivering compelling performances across a variety of genres. From the teenage angst of Kick-Ass (2010) to the romantic drama of Nowhere Boy (2009), where he played a young John Lennon, he's shown a remarkable range. He’s demonstrated an ability to handle action sequences, emotional depth, and charisma – all essential ingredients for a successful Bond. Remember his performance in Avengers: Age of Ultron (2015), as Quicksilver? Even though his time in the MCU was brief, he brought a certain energy and physicality to the role that showcased his action potential. More recently, his roles in Bullet Train (2022) and Kraven the Hunter (upcoming) have further solidified his action credentials, making him a prime candidate for a role that demands both physical prowess and dramatic acting.
